If you had a slope of 3 and a y-intercept of 2, the equation should be

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 09-09-2020

Answer:

[tex]y=3x+2[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

There is enough information to make a equation in slope-intercept form.

[tex]y=mx+b[/tex]

'm' is the slope. 'b' is the y-intercept.  

In the given question, 3 is the slope and 2 is the y-intercept. This means that:

m = 3

b = 2

Plug in the appropriate values:

[tex]y=mx+b\rightarrow\boxed{y=3x+2}[/tex]
